What Is a Liquidity Provider?

A liquidity provider is a person, firm, protocol, or wallet that supplies assets so other users can trade, borrow, lend, or exchange crypto more easily.

In crypto, the term usually refers to users who deposit tokens into a decentralized finance liquidity pool.

A liquidity provider may also refer to a professional market participant that supports order book liquidity by quoting buy and sell prices.

The main purpose of a liquidity provider is to make markets deeper, smoother, and easier to use.

When liquidity is strong, traders can enter or exit positions with less price impact.

When liquidity is weak, even a small trade can move the market sharply.

For crypto users, liquidity providers are important because they support token swaps, lending markets, stablecoin markets, decentralized exchanges, and many other DeFi applications.

How Liquidity Providers Work in Crypto

A liquidity provider supplies crypto assets to a market or protocol.

In an automated market maker, the liquidity provider deposits tokens into a smart contract called a liquidity pool.

The Bank for International Settlements overview of automated market makers explains that AMM protocols let traders exchange crypto assets automatically through liquidity pools supplied by liquidity providers.

When traders use the pool, they pay fees or trading costs that may be shared with liquidity providers.

The pool’s pricing logic adjusts token prices based on the amount of each asset inside the pool.

This means traders do not need to wait for another person to place a matching buy or sell order.

They trade directly against pooled liquidity.

Liquidity Provider in DeFi

In DeFi, a liquidity provider is usually an ordinary user who deposits assets into a smart contract.

The Ethereum DeFi guide explains that decentralized finance uses blockchain-based applications to recreate financial services without relying on traditional intermediaries.

Liquidity providers are one of the main reasons DeFi markets can function without a central market operator.

Instead of a company holding inventory, many users pool their assets together.

Other users can then swap, borrow, repay, or trade against that liquidity.

The liquidity provider earns potential rewards for making assets available.

Those rewards may include trading fees, lending interest, incentive tokens, or other protocol-defined returns.

Liquidity Provider in an Order Book

A liquidity provider can also operate in an order book market.

In an order book, buyers place bids and sellers place asks.

The Investor.gov bid and ask definition explains that the bid is the highest price a buyer is willing to pay, while the ask is the lowest price a seller is willing to accept.

A professional liquidity provider may place both bids and asks to help keep the market active.

The Investor.gov market maker glossary describes a market maker as a firm that stands ready to buy or sell at publicly quoted prices.

In crypto, this type of liquidity provision can support tighter spreads and better execution.

However, professional liquidity provision requires inventory management, risk controls, fast systems, and strong compliance processes.

Liquidity Pool

A liquidity pool is a smart contract that holds crypto assets supplied by liquidity providers.

In a basic two-token pool, liquidity providers deposit two assets into the pool.

For example, a pool may contain Token A and Token B.

Traders use the pool to swap Token A for Token B or Token B for Token A.

The pool adjusts prices according to its formula and current token balances.

In many AMM designs, larger trades against shallow pools create more price impact.

This is why deeper liquidity usually creates a better trading experience.

LP Tokens

LP tokens are tokens that represent a liquidity provider’s share of a liquidity pool.

When a user deposits assets into a pool, the protocol may mint LP tokens or create another position record.

These LP tokens show how much of the pool the user owns.

When the user withdraws liquidity, the LP tokens may be burned or the position may be closed.

The user then receives their share of the pool’s assets, plus any earned fees or rewards, minus any losses, fees, or penalties.

LP tokens can be useful, but they can also add risk if they are deposited into other protocols.

A user who loses LP tokens may lose the claim to the underlying liquidity.

How Liquidity Providers Earn Rewards

Liquidity providers usually earn rewards because their assets make trading or lending possible.

In swap pools, liquidity providers may earn a share of trading fees.

In lending markets, liquidity providers may earn interest from borrowers.

In some protocols, liquidity providers may also earn incentive tokens for supporting a pool.

These rewards are not guaranteed profit.

The value of deposited assets can change while they are in the pool.

A liquidity provider must compare earned fees and rewards with risks such as impermanent loss, smart contract failure, token price decline, and withdrawal limitations.

Impermanent Loss

Impermanent loss is one of the most important risks for DeFi liquidity providers.

The Chainlink impermanent loss guide defines impermanent loss as the difference between providing assets to a liquidity pool and simply holding those assets in a wallet when their prices change.

Impermanent loss happens because the pool automatically rebalances token amounts as traders swap against it.

If one token rises sharply compared with the other, the liquidity provider may end up with less of the rising token and more of the weaker token.

The position may still be profitable if fees are high enough.

However, if fees do not offset the loss, the user may be worse off than simply holding the assets.

The risk becomes larger when the two assets in the pool move very differently in price.

Price Impact and Slippage

Price impact is the change in price caused by a trade itself.

Slippage is the difference between the expected trade price and the final executed price.

Liquidity providers reduce price impact by adding more depth to the market.

A deep pool can usually absorb a larger trade with less movement.

A shallow pool may move sharply from a relatively small trade.

This matters for traders because poor liquidity can make a trade more expensive than expected.

It also matters for liquidity providers because high volume can create more fees, while extreme volatility can create more risk.

Concentrated Liquidity

Concentrated liquidity is a design where liquidity providers choose a specific price range for their assets.

Instead of spreading liquidity across all possible prices, the user places liquidity where they expect trading to happen.

This can make capital more efficient because the same amount of money can support more trading near the current market price.

However, concentrated liquidity also requires more active management.

If the market price moves outside the chosen range, the position may stop earning trading fees.

The liquidity provider may also end up holding mostly one asset after a large price move.

This makes concentrated liquidity powerful for experienced users but risky for users who do not monitor their positions.

Single-Sided Liquidity

Single-sided liquidity means a user provides only one asset instead of a pair of assets.

Some DeFi protocols use internal mechanisms to convert, pair, or balance that asset behind the scenes.

This can make liquidity provision easier for users who do not want to hold both sides of a trading pair.

However, single-sided liquidity is not automatically safer.

The protocol may still expose the user to price risk, smart contract risk, pool imbalance, withdrawal fees, or delayed exits.

Users should read how the protocol manages the other side of the pool.

They should also check whether the displayed yield is paid from real trading activity, emissions, or temporary incentives.

Liquidity Provider and Stablecoin Pools

Stablecoin pools are common places for liquidity providers because the paired assets are designed to stay close in value.

When two assets are highly correlated, impermanent loss may be lower than in volatile token pairs.

This is why many users see stablecoin liquidity provision as less volatile than providing liquidity for newly launched tokens.

However, stablecoin pools still have risks.

A stablecoin can lose its peg, a protocol can suffer a smart contract exploit, or a pool can become imbalanced.

Liquidity can also disappear during market stress.

Stablecoin pools may be lower volatility, but they are not risk-free.

Liquidity Provider and Yield Farming

Yield farming is the practice of moving crypto assets between protocols to earn rewards.

Liquidity providers often participate in yield farming by depositing LP tokens into reward contracts.

This can increase returns but also increases complexity.

The user may face risk from the original pool, the reward contract, the reward token, and any additional protocol involved.

High advertised yield can come from high token emissions rather than sustainable trading activity.

If the reward token falls in price, the real return may be much lower than expected.

Liquidity providers should understand the source of yield before chasing high percentages.

Benefits of Being a Liquidity Provider

The first benefit is fee income.

Liquidity providers can earn a share of trading fees or lending interest when their assets are used.

The second benefit is market support.

Providing liquidity can help a token, pool, or DeFi protocol become more usable.

The third benefit is onchain participation.

Users can take part in open financial markets directly through smart contracts.

The fourth benefit is potential incentive rewards.

Some protocols reward early or strategic liquidity providers with extra tokens or points.

The fifth benefit is flexibility because users can choose different pools, assets, risk levels, and strategies.

Risks of Being a Liquidity Provider

The first risk is impermanent loss.

The second risk is smart contract failure.

The third risk is token price decline.

The fourth risk is low liquidity during exits.

The fifth risk is reward-token inflation.

The sixth risk is protocol governance changes.

The seventh risk is malicious pools or fake token contracts.

The eighth risk is user error, such as approving a bad contract or depositing into the wrong pool.

How to Evaluate a Liquidity Provider Opportunity

Start by checking the assets in the pool.

Highly volatile or low-quality tokens can create large losses even when the fee rate looks attractive.

Next, check pool volume, total value locked, fee history, and reward sources.

A pool with real trading volume may be more sustainable than a pool paying rewards only through new token emissions.

Review the protocol’s audits, smart contract history, admin controls, and governance structure.

Check whether withdrawals are instant, delayed, or subject to conditions.

Finally, compare the likely return with simply holding the assets outside the pool.

Liquidity Provider vs. Market Maker

A liquidity provider is a broad term for anyone who supplies assets to make trading or lending easier.

A market maker is a more specific type of liquidity provider that continuously offers to buy and sell at quoted prices.

In DeFi, many liquidity providers are passive users who deposit funds into pools.

In order book markets, market makers are often professional firms using automated systems.

Both roles support liquidity, but they work in different market structures.

AMM liquidity providers supply pooled assets to smart contracts.

Order book market makers manage inventory and quote prices directly.

Common Misunderstandings About Liquidity Providers

One common misunderstanding is that liquidity providers always earn passive income.

Fees and rewards can be offset by impermanent loss, token decline, or smart contract problems.

Another misunderstanding is that higher APY always means a better opportunity.

Very high yields often come with very high risk.

A third misunderstanding is that stablecoin pools are completely safe.

Stablecoin pools can still face peg risk, protocol risk, and liquidity risk.

A fourth misunderstanding is that LP tokens are just reward tokens.

LP tokens usually represent ownership of deposited assets, so losing them can mean losing the underlying position.
